Bexar County Appraisal District 2022 Houses Property Tax Protest Summary
Out of $157 billion in total property value, $42 billion in property tax protests were filed with the Bexar Appraisal District (CAD) in 2022 by property owners. 21% of houses were protested based on Bexar CAD noticed value. Compared to owners of ordinary houses, owners of more costly homes are more inclined to protest. Protests are much more common among owners of utilities, commercial space, and apartments. Based on value, the owners of 100% of commercial, 5% of multifamily, and 100% of utilities appealed. BexarCAD Houses Property Tax Summary
Market Value Houses / Condos / Townhomes | $157,240,349,467 |
Number Single Family Property Tax Protests | 126,695 |
$ Value Single Family (Homes, Condo, Townhome) Protested | $42,371,466,739 |
$ Value of Houses Resolved at Informal Protest | 92,155 |
# of Property Tax Protest Hearings for Houses (ARB) | 14,346 |
# Houses with Reduction at ARB Protest Hearing | 14,100 |
$ Reduction Houses at ARB Protest Hearing | $564,020,188 |
# Lawsuits Filed for Houses on ARB Values | 16 |
ARB Value of All Lawsuits Filed for Single-Family / Houses | $83,689,190 |
$ Reduction Property Tax Lawsuits for Houses Current Year | $4,395,025 |
